Definitions from Wiktionary (main road)
▸ noun: A major road in a town or village, or in a country area.
▸ noun: (Northeastern US, UK) A major urban road, off which lead many smaller streets, many of them cul-de-sacs.
▸ noun: (South Africa) High Street; Main Street
▸ noun: (in some countries) priority road; A road with entering traffic which must yield right of way
